William Henry Fox Talbot (1800–1877) is a key figure in the history of photography: he invented early photographic processes and established the basic principle of photography as a negative/positive process. In this article, we’ll take a journey back in time to explore the famous first photographs in history, some of the oldest photos to have ever been captured.First Underwater Portrait (1899) In 1899, Louis Boutan, a French biologist and photographer, made history by capturing the first underwater portrait. His brave subject, Emil Racovitza, had to pose and hold still for 30 minutes in the waters of Banyuls-Sur-Mer, France. A major purpose of …History of Photographic Film - First Photographic Plates. Photographic film is a material used in photographic cameras to record images. It is made of transparent plastic in a shape of a strip or sheet, and it has one side covered with light-sensitive silver halide crystals made into a gelatinous emulsion. The oldest surviving image at the Australian Museum is likely to date back to 1860.Battle of Antietam (1862) The photo above shows fallen Confederate soldiers in the aftermath of the Battle of Antietam, taken in September 1862. The Battle of Antietam was one of the deadliest days in American history, causing around 23,000 casualties. During the American Civil War, photography extensively documented the realities of war.Robert Cornelius was an American photographer and pioneer in the history of photography. Around October 1839, at age 30, Cornelius took a self-portrait outside the family store. The daguerreotype produced is an off-center portrait of himself with crossed arms and tousled hair. In 1887, Adolf Miethe and Johannes Gaedicke mixed fine magnesium powder with potassium chlorate to produce Blitzlicht. This was the first ever widely used flash powder.
